In light of the tensions witnessed in relations between Egypt and Israel, since the Israeli forces took control of the Palestinian side of the Rafah border crossing, and the wider incursion of Israeli tanks into the east of the city of Rafah, which is crowded with displaced people, the Israeli government added fuel to the fire.

Government spokesman David Mincer announced on Wednesday that his country had asked Egypt, which shares a common border with Gaza, to open the way for Palestinian civilians who wish to flee the war to enter its territory, but Cairo refused. He also renewed his country's commitment to eliminating "the four remaining Hamas brigades in Rafah."

He added, "Not all Hamas members must be there," referring to Rafah. Over the past two days, Cairo and Tel Aviv have exchanged pushback and response. After Israeli Foreign Minister Yisrael Katz accused the Egyptian side of closing the Rafah crossing and thus obstructing the entry of aid, his Egyptian counterpart, Sameh Shukri, confirmed that Tel Aviv’s control of the crossing on October 7 was what stopped relief work for the residents of Gaza.

Egypt has also repeatedly repeated over the past few days its rejection of a ground incursion into Rafah, or the invasion of the border city crowded with displaced people, which previously housed more than a million and a half Palestinians, especially as there is no safe place for them to take refuge.

During the recent period, Cairo strongly protested the invasion of Rafah, saying that the operation endangered the peace treaty, and some Egyptian officials threatened to reduce diplomatic relations and withdraw the ambassador from Tel Aviv. It is noteworthy that since the outbreak of the war in Gaza, on October 7, Egypt has been warning against the forced displacement of Palestinians from the Gaza Strip, stressing its rejection of any old, premeditated Israeli plans to settle Palestinians in Sinai.

On the other hand, the Israeli Broadcasting Authority reported today (Sunday) that Defense Minister Yoav Gallant called on Prime Minister Benjamin Netanyahu during a session of the Ministerial Council for Political and Security Affairs to approve the Egyptian proposal regarding the Gaza Strip, according to what was reported by the Arab World News Agency.

The broadcasting authority quoted Gallant as saying during a council meeting: “This is a good deal and it is our chance to return the kidnapped people to the homeland.” The Minister of Defense added: “We are required on a moral and ethical level to return the kidnapped people, especially you and me, the Prime Minister and Minister of Defense since October 7.” “I am not speaking publicly so as not to raise the price, but this deal must be approved.”

The broadcasting authority said that the Egyptian initiative “received the support of all members of the Ministerial Council, including officials in the security services.” According to the commission, Netanyahu expressed “reservations, but in the end the broad outlines” of the Egyptian initiative were approved.

The authority added that Netanyahu and the heads of the security services decided in a session of the expanded government that was held after the session of the Ministerial Council for Political and Security Affairs not to present the broad outlines to the members of the government “for fear of leaks that would harm the negotiations.”

The Hamas movement announced earlier today that its delegation left Cairo, following a round of negotiations, to consult with the movement’s leadership about a possible truce and prisoner exchange agreement with Israel. The movement said, in a statement, that the delegation delivered the mediators in Egypt and Qatar “Hamas’ response, where in-depth and serious discussions took place with them.” The statement added: “The movement affirms its positive and responsible approach, and its keenness and determination to reach an agreement that meets the national demands of our people, ends the aggression completely, achieves withdrawal from the entire Gaza Strip, returns the displaced, intensifies relief, begins reconstruction, and completes the prisoner exchange deal.”
